WebAlcohol misuse is the commonest reason for increases in CDT levels. In most studies of CDT in subjects potentially misusing alcohol the test has 95% specificity i.e. 19 out of 20 times the increased CDT is due to excess alcohol intake. Web7 Mar 2024 · A Carbohydrate Deficient Transferrin test, also known as a CDT blood alcohol test, is used to establish the percentage of transferrin in the bloodstream that is carbohydrate deficient. Transferrin is a protein largely made in the liver that regulates the absorption of iron into the blood, and transports iron to the parts of the body that need it. Web1 Jun 2024 · Carbohydrate-deficient transferrin (CDT), also known as desialotransferrin or asialotransferrin) is a laboratory test used to help detect heavy ethanol consumption. Transferrin is a substance in the blood that carries iron to the bone marrow, liver, and spleen.
